Description
Aya Arisugawa, a spirited high school classmate of Nasa Yuzaki, balances airheaded spontaneity with a carefree charm. Though openly harboring feelings for Nasa, she channels mature selflessness by wholeheartedly supporting his marriage to Tsukasa, prioritizing their happiness over her own heart.
Hailing from the Arisugawa family, stewards of a local public bathhouse, Aya contrasts her sister Kaname’s lively matchmaking antics with a more reserved demeanor. Her love for video games underscores a playful, modern youthfulness.
When Nasa assumes a teaching role at an all-girls school in *High School Days*, Aya navigates his newfound popularity among students seeking romantic advice. Through these interactions, she remains authentically cheerful and steadfast, quietly reinforcing her acceptance of his committed relationship while maintaining their lighthearted friendship.
